Summit of the CIS heads in Minsk demonstrated further deepening degradation of this organization built on the ruins of the Soviet Union, and intended to unite around the New Russia the pieces of the former Soviet and Tsarist empires.The format and the spirit of the summit showed that a union of sovereign states is hopelessly ill, and Ukraine, after Georgia, became the second country of the Commonwealth which nailed the coffin of the dying CIS. In a significant diplomatic move, President Kassym-Jomart Tokayev of Kazakhstan embarked on an official visit to Armenia, marking a pivotal moment in the relationship between the two nations. The meeting between President Tokayev and Armenian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an resulted in the signing of a joint statement aimed at fostering cooperation and easing tensions that had simmered between the two countries.
